New border controls at entry and exit, 9 EU countries postpone full implementation of measures

Nine European Union countries, including France, Greece, Italy and Portugal, are asking for more time to fully implement the new EES entry-exit system, particularly for taking fingerprints and biometric data of citizens from countries outside the EU.

The new system aims to modernise border controls in the Schengen area, but its implementation has faced difficulties at some of Europe's busiest airports and border crossings. Germany, Malta, the Netherlands, Switzerland and Belgium are also among the countries that have requested additional time to complete implementation.

 
The EES was scheduled to enter into full force on September 6, after several previous delays. The system was approved by the EU in 2017 and officially launched in October last year, with the aim of becoming fully operational in April.

Technical problems and the risk of long queues at tourist airports have forced some countries to seek a more gradual approach. Spain, which had problems during the early stages of implementation, is now fully implementing the system.

According to EU sources, the system has registered around 200 million entries, while around 70,000 people have been denied entry to the Schengen area. The number of people denied entry has increased from around 43,700 in June.

The EES records the biometric data of non-EU travellers and is used to identify people who overstay. For British citizens, for example, the system is linked to a limit of 90 days within a 180-day period.

European authorities say the system has also helped detect people using forged documents. The combination of fingerprints and facial images enables the identification of individuals trying to travel with different passports.

However, implementation is not uniform at all border crossings. Biometric data collection has started at some points, including the Eurostar terminal in Brussels and the port of Antwerp, while some other airports have not yet completed the process.

 
Large international hubs, such as Frankfurt Airport and Schiphol, are already collecting biometric data, while some smaller airports have encountered difficulties due to limited capacity.

EU sources report that only 12 out of around 1,500 border crossings continue to have significant problems with the implementation of the system.

One of the main concerns is related to small airports, where the number of passengers can increase significantly during the tourist season. In one case cited by the EU, about 3,000 passengers could arrive within an hour, while the border crossing had only four booths for biometric registration.

The aviation industry has also warned of problems. The International Air Transport Association has previously called for the system to be completely suspended, arguing that delays have caused passengers to miss connecting flights in countries such as Spain, Italy, Greece and Belgium.

Ryanair has also warned of long queues and chaos at several airports, including Malaga and Palma.

France faces a unique situation at the port of Dover, where French border checks are carried out on British territory before travel to France. The collection of biometric data at this point has not yet been implemented.
